Output 209d8529089dd240a1763119f8385f4414a0c5d1dd284bae8cecf62c786c4bc0:1

value
17925576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b760d79d4f5e3d30ababd3f3af25f343e8016a8b OP_EQUAL
address
3JQdbNApMfcUhAtReDJX2ozH2PgX9ecEEp
transaction
209d8529089dd240a1763119f8385f4414a0c5d1dd284bae8cecf62c786c4bc0
spent
true